By Product Type

Automatic Barriers :

Automatic barriers have emerged as a crucial product type in the automated barriers and bollards market. These barriers are designed to provide controlled access to restricted areas by automatically rising or lowering upon the identification of authorized vehicles. They are widely used in applications such as parking lots, toll booths, and access points to commercial buildings. The primary advantage of automatic barriers lies in their ability to enhance security while simultaneously improving traffic flow. The integration of advanced technologies, such as RFID and facial recognition, has made these barriers more sophisticated, allowing for seamless and secure entry. Additionally, their ability to withstand various weather conditions and provide durability has further contributed to their growing adoption across different sectors. The demand for automatic barriers is expected to rise significantly as urban areas continue to expand and the need for effective access control becomes more pronounced.

Rising Bollards :

Rising bollards are gaining traction as an effective solution for vehicle access control in both commercial and residential areas. These bollards are designed to rise and lower vertically, providing a barrier to prevent unauthorized vehicles from entering restricted areas. Their versatility makes them suitable for a variety of applications, including outdoor dining areas, pedestrian zones, and high-security facilities. Rising bollards offer the added advantage of being able to provide security while maintaining an aesthetic appeal, which is essential in urban planning. The increasing trend towards the incorporation of smart technologies within rising bollards, such as remote control and automation via mobile applications, is expected to further fuel their popularity in the coming years. As cities continue to prioritize pedestrian safety and control over vehicle access, rising bollards are likely to become an indispensable component of urban infrastructure.

Sliding Bollards :

Sliding bollards are another notable type within the automated barriers and bollards market. These bollards operate by sliding horizontally to provide access or restrict entry to vehicles. Their unique design allows for the efficient management of traffic in high-traffic areas, such as airports, shopping complexes, and event venues, where quick access control is essential. Sliding bollards are advantageous in situations where space is limited, as they do not require a significant area for operation compared to traditional rising bollards. Their ability to operate in conjunction with advanced security systems ensures a more secure environment, making them increasingly popular among businesses seeking robust access solutions. The market for sliding bollards is anticipated to expand as urban development and infrastructural projects increase, necessitating innovative traffic management solutions.

Retractable Bollards :

Retractable bollards present a versatile solution for access control in various environments. These bollards can be retracted into the ground when access is permitted and raised when a barrier is needed, making them highly adaptable for fluctuating traffic conditions. They are predominantly utilized in areas where both vehicle access and pedestrian traffic are prevalent, such as park entrances and plazas. Their retractable nature allows for the efficient use of space, maintaining the aesthetic quality of public areas while providing the necessary security features. The growing focus on smart city developments and the integration of technology into infrastructure further support the adoption of retractable bollards. As more cities recognize the need for multifunctional solutions that cater to both security and accessibility, the demand for retractable bollards is expected to rise significantly.

Fixed Bollards :

Fixed bollards serve as permanent barriers designed to restrict vehicle access in specific areas. Commonly used in high-security zones, pedestrian-heavy regions, and parking facilities, fixed bollards provide a robust solution to prevent unauthorized vehicle entry. Their durability and resistance to impacts ensure that they maintain their structural integrity, which is critical in high-traffic areas. Fixed bollards are available in various materials and designs, allowing for customization based on specific site requirements. Their presence is increasingly prominent in urban landscapes, where public safety and traffic management are priorities. With the ongoing expansion of urban infrastructure and growing concerns over vehicle-related incidents, the demand for fixed bollards is expected to continue to rise, solidifying their role as an essential component of urban planning.

By Material Type

Stainless Steel :

Stainless steel is a popular material choice for automated barriers and bollards due to its durability, strength, and resistance to corrosion. This material is particularly suitable for outdoor applications, as it can withstand harsh weather conditions without deteriorating. Stainless steel barriers and bollards offer a modern aesthetic appeal, making them an attractive option for urban environments. Their robustness makes them ideal for high-security applications, where the ability to resist impacts is crucial. The rising trend towards sustainability and eco-friendly materials has also contributed to the growing popularity of stainless steel in the market. As businesses and municipalities continue to seek reliable and long-lasting access control solutions, the demand for stainless steel barriers and bollards is expected to increase.

Concrete :

Concrete is a widely used material in the construction of automated barriers and bollards due to its robustness and ability to withstand heavy impacts. Concrete bollards serve as effective deterrents against unauthorized vehicle access and are often employed in high-security locations such as government buildings and military facilities. The longevity of concrete makes it a cost-effective choice for many applications, as it requires minimal maintenance over time. Moreover, concrete barriers can be customized with various finishes and colors to blend seamlessly into their surroundings. As the focus on safety and protection increases in urban planning, the demand for concrete barriers and bollards is anticipated to grow significantly.

Plastic :

Plastic barriers and bollards provide a lightweight and cost-effective solution for access control in various applications. They are often utilized in low-traffic areas or temporary installations, where flexibility and portability are essential. Plastic bollards are available in a range of colors and designs, allowing for customization to suit specific aesthetic requirements. Their resistance to corrosion and UV degradation makes them suitable for outdoor use. However, while plastic barriers may not offer the same level of durability as metal or concrete options, they provide a viable alternative for situations where budget constraints are a concern. As businesses and municipalities seek affordable security solutions, the popularity of plastic barriers and bollards is likely to increase.

Aluminum :

Aluminum is increasingly being used in the manufacture of automated barriers and bollards due to its lightweight nature and resistance to corrosion. This material offers a balance between strength and flexibility, making it suitable for various applications, including residential and commercial installations. Aluminum barriers can be easily transported and installed, which is an advantage for businesses looking for efficient solutions. Additionally, aluminum's malleability allows for intricate designs and customizations, ensuring that the barriers meet specific aesthetic preferences. As urbanization continues and the demand for modern access control solutions rises, the use of aluminum in automated barriers and bollards is expected to grow.

Wrought Iron :

Wrought iron is a traditional material known for its strength and durability, making it a favored choice for automated barriers and bollards in high-security applications. Its classic aesthetic appeal adds a timeless element to urban landscapes, often making it a preferred option for decorative installations in parks, historical sites, and upscale neighborhoods. Wrought iron barriers provide a formidable physical presence, deterring unauthorized vehicle entry effectively. However, they may require more maintenance compared to other materials due to susceptibility to rust. As the demand for security solutions that combine functionality with visual appeal increases, wrought iron barriers and bollards are likely to maintain their relevance in the market.
